misterp Posted January 18, 2009 Report Share Posted January 18, 2009 (edited) The MPH governor on the stock PCM for 2WD EC rear-drum brake trucks is 98-mph; the factory sets this value based on the tires and brakes originally fit on the vehicle. The CC trucks might be 95-mph because of GVW but I don't think so, I belive they are set to 98-mph like the EC trucks are. Mr. P. Edited January 18, 2009 by Mr. P.
